Coupsil® 8113 by Evonik is a reinforcing filler based on precipitated silica, surface modified with organosilane Si 69®. It reacts with unsaturated polymer during vulcanization under formation of covalent chemical bonds. It imparts greater tensile strength, higher moduli, reduced compression set, increased abrasion resistance and optimized dynamic properties. Offers the advantage of a homogeneous modification with low moisture adsorption during storage and significantly lower development of ethanol during mixing and processing. Applications for Coupsil® 8113 include low rolling resistant tires with high wet grip and low heat generation, mechanical rubber goods, shoe soles. It has a shelf life of 12 months.

Coupsil® VP 6411 by Evonik acts as a reinforcing filler in rubber compounds. It imparts greater tensile strength, higher moduli, optimized dynamic properties, lower compression set values and better abrasion resistance. It appears as a white powder and reacts with unsaturated polymers during vulcanization under formation of covalent chemical bonds. It offers the advantage of a homogeneous modification with low moisture adsorption during storage and significantly lower development of ethanol during mixing and processing. It is a reaction product of organosilane Si 264® [3Thiocyanatopropyltriethoxysilane] with 100 parts and Ultrasil® VN 2 with 11 parts. Coupsil® VP 6411 is used for mechanical rubber goods.
Coupsil® VP 6508 by Evonik acts as a reinforcing filler. Designed for peroxide-cured rubber compounds where optimum technical properties are required. Imparts greater tensile strength, higher modulus, optimized dynamic properties, lower compression set values and better abrasion resistance. It reacts with unsaturated polymers during vulcanization under the formation of covalent chemical bonds. Offers homogeneous modification with low moisture adsorption during storage and significantly lowers development of ethanol during mixing and processing. It is a reaction product of organosilane Dynasylan® VTEO [vinyltriethoxysilane] with 8 parts and Ultrasil® VN 2 with 100 parts. Coupsil® VP 6508 has a shelf life of 24 months.
